This is the Alum Cave Trail all the way up to Mount Le Conte Lodge. In all it is an 11 mile hike that is strenuous and will take about 6 to 7 hours to complete round trip. Make sure you have water and food in a day pack. Ladies there is an outhouse at Mount Le Conte Lodge for those passing by to use. The views are spectacular and the trail is narrow in many places make sure you have a good hiking shoe and a walking stick might not hurt either.
